dc.description.abstractThis project is about on testing, inspection and certification (TIC) industry and to identify how this industry makes their Human Resource Planning and also how they execute their staffing strategy. For that reason, I have taken Intertek Bangladesh as a sample. Intertek which is a leading service provider in Bangladesh since . They do have a structured HR department so I tried to know how the company performs the necessary HR functions, like Human Resource Planning and staffing strategy. For that reason I have tried to identify their recruitment process, and how they train their employees. To get a good idea I have worked there as a intern. From the experience I have found that in Intertek BD there is existence of a structured HR department, having proper Job Description and Specification. Directors and other departmental heads handle the recruitment process.Finally, I have tried my best to give them the proper recommendations to make sure that they have a competitive advantage. For instance, HR positions the company should take only those people who have a sound knowledge of HR, they can differentiate their organization from the competitors by giving various types of benefits to their employees, Balanced Scorecard Process and Training and Development etc.en_US
